Missile fields of South Dakota

In Minuteman Missile, this map shows where the missile fields once stood, spread over thousands of square miles of desolate fields so it would be hard to take out more than one with a single nuclear warhead. Peace activists from the local communities mapped the fields and publicized the locations of every missile, driving the backcountry road until they found anomalous fences and security in the middle of desolate fields and hills.
